HTML(HyperText Markup Language)是创建网页和Web应用程序的标准标记语言,自1990年首次发布以来,HTML已经经历了多次更新和改进,从最初的HTML 1.0到现在的HTML5,它已经成为构建丰富、互动且跨平台兼容的网络内容的基石。
图片来源于网络,如有侵权联系删除
HTML的历史与演变
早期版本
- HTML 1.0:最初由Tim Berners-Lee在1993年发布的版本,奠定了超文本链接的基础。
- HTML 2.0:作为RFC 1866,于1999年发布,引入了更多的元素和属性,但仍然相对简单。
标准化进程
- W3C标准化:1997年,万维网联盟(W3C)发布了HTML 3.2规范,这是第一个经过正式标准化的HTML版本。
- HTML 4.0:于1998年发布,引入了 Frameset DOCTYPE 和更多语义化标签,如
和等。
移动互联网时代
- HTML 4.01:于1999年发布,是对HTML 4.0的一个修正版,解决了浏览器兼容性问题。
- XHTML 1.0:2000年发布,旨在将XML应用于HTML,使HTML文档更加严格地遵循XML语法规则。
HTML5革命
- HTML5:于2014年成为正式标准,标志着HTML的一次重大飞跃,它不仅增加了新的元素和特性,还提供了更好的多媒体支持、本地存储以及更强大的表单功能。
HTML的基本结构
任何HTML页面都由一系列标签组成,这些标签定义了页面的不同部分及其显示方式,以下是一些基本的HTML标签:
<html>
:整个HTML文档的根元素。<head>
:包含关于文档的信息,如标题、元数据等。
:设置浏览器的标签页名称或窗口标题。
<body>
:实际可见的部分,包括文字、图片和其他媒体内容。<h1>
至<h6>
:用于表示不同级别的标题。<p>
:段落标记。<a>
:锚点标签,用于创建超链接。<img>
:用于嵌入图像。<ul>
/<ol>
:无序列表和有序列表。<li>
:列表项。<div>
/<span>
:容器元素,用于分组和样式应用。
HTML中的高级功能
随着技术的进步,HTML也不断扩展其功能,以适应现代Web开发的需求。
- 语义化标签:如
<article>
、<section>
、<footer>
等,它们为网页内容提供了更好的上下文描述。 - 响应式设计:通过使用CSS媒体查询和Flexbox/Grid布局技术,实现跨设备自适应显示效果。
- 本地存储:利用localStorage和sessionStorage实现数据的客户端缓存,提高用户体验和数据安全性。
- 离线应用:借助AppCache API,允许在没有网络连接的情况下运行Web应用程序。
尽管HTML已经非常强大,但它仍在不断发展,未来的版本可能会进一步整合JavaScript和其他编程语言的特性,使得Web开发的边界更加广阔,WebAssembly(Wasm)的出现就为高性能计算任务打开了新的大门,而WebGPU则有望带来更流畅的游戏体验和高效率的数据处理能力。
图片来源于网络,如有侵权联系删除
HTML不仅是构建网站的起点,更是推动数字世界不断创新的核心力量,无论是初学者还是经验丰富的开发者,都应该持续关注和学习最新的HTML技术和最佳实践,以便更好地应对不断变化的互联网环境。
标签: #html网站
评论列表